TeamViewer Motive 2

SSD Raid für CAD Berechnungen

remedin

Cadet 1st Year
Registriert
Aug. 2012
Beiträge
8
Hallo,
ich bin IT Betreuer in einer Abteilung die sehr viele Berechnungen an CAD Modellen durchführt(hauptsächlich mit der Software Ansys)
wir konnten schon einiges an Zeit einsparen indem wir von HDD's auf SSD's umgestiegen sind(ca faktor 5)
Wie es immer so ist versucht man natürlich noch mehr rauszuholen.
in dem Letzten System habe ich ein RAID 0 aus 4 SSD's an einem seperatem RAID-Controller eingebaut.
die Komponenten:
Raid Controller: LSI MegaRAID SAS 9271CV-8i
SSD's: Kingston HyperX 128GB
Workstation: Fujitsu Celsius R930 mit 2 CPU's und 128GB RAM
Vergleichswerte habe ich hier leider noch keine zur einzelnen SSD
es steht bald wieder eine Rechneranschaffung an deswegen wollte ich mich mal informieren ob es nicht noch eine bessere Lösung gibt. PCI-e SSD's habe ich auch schon ins Auge gefasst aber die "richtig dicken Brocken" wie zb von Fusion IO(die wirklich beachtliche Werte vorweißen) kosten da eine ganze Stange Geld was in dem Fall das Budget bei weitem sprengt.
Speicherplatz wird für die Rechen-Festplatte ca 2 TB benötigt(ja die files sind wirklich sehr groß) deshlab musste ich einen Rechner schon mit 2X 1 TB EVO's im RAID 0 aufrüsten.

Als nächste config hatte ich in etwa angedacht den gleichen Raid-Controller zu verwenden(LSI MegaRAID SAS 9271CV-8i) und dazu 4X Samsung 840 pro 512 GB.
habe nämlich heute in einem Testbericht gelesen dass die EVO zb nur auf so hohe schreibwerte kommen weil sie eine art Schreibcache haben der aber nach 3 GB "aufgebraucht" ist und sie dann in der schreibrate einrechen(bei sequentiellen schreibvorgängen zb).

was meint ihr dazu?

Gruß Remedin
 
Warum haust Du nicht so viel RAM in die Rechner dass die Berechnungen im Hauptspeicher durchführt werden? Und ob Dein Storage überhaupt der Flaschenhals ist, würde doch ein Blick auf die LED vom Controller klären. Ist die nicht dauerhaft an, IST es nicht Deine Speicherlösung, die den Flaschenhals darstellt.
 
Zuletzt bearbeitet:
Wie der TE schon schreibt sind die Files wohl extrem groß, von daher könnte es schwierig/ teuer werden genug RAM zu finden um so zu arbeiten.
 
Je nach Größe der Berechnungen werden bei uns bei Simulationen oft mehrere 100GB Temp Dateien geschrieben und ich verstehe schon die Idee dahinter.
Allerdings ist es bei Simulationsprogrammen oft so, dass wenn die IOs der Platten ausreichend sind diese dann ins CPU Limit krachen.

Raidcontroller können die IO Leistung von von SSDs stark mindern, aber die aktuellen sollten das ganz gut hinbekommen.
Von Consumer SSDs in solchen Maschinen halte ich persönlich garnix.

Bei unsrem NX Nastran Maschinchen war ich schon ein paar mal am überlegen ob ich nicht so nen automatischen Wechsler einbaue, da der alleine letzten Sommer 2 SSDs (irgendwelche Sandforce) verheizt hat.

Bin dann auf die Samsung SM843T gestoßen und hab ne 1TB davon verbaut die die 80GB Ram unterstützt.
Ich würde dir also wenn dann bei SSDs die Data Center Editionen ans Herz legen.
 
Zuletzt bearbeitet:
flo36 schrieb:
J...die die 80GB Ram unterstützt.
was meinst du damit genau?
flo36 schrieb:
Ich würde dir also wenn dann bei SSDs die Data Center Editionen ans Herz legen.
das Problem ist von den ganzen SSD's die wir mittlerweile im Einsatz haben ist noch keine einzige abgeraucht d.h. kann ich da erst mal nicht argumentieren :)
flo36 schrieb:
Je nach Größe der Berechnungen werden bei uns bei Simulationen oft mehrere 100GB Temp Dateien geschrieben und ich verstehe schon die Idee dahinter.
Allerdings ist es bei Simulationsprogrammen oft so, dass wenn die IOs der Platten ausreichend sind diese dann ins CPU Limit krachen.
Ja, ich vermute auch dass aktuell auch die CPU eine entscheidende Rolle bei der Berechnungsgeschwindigkeit ist, da viele Rechnungen komplett in den RAM passen. ANSYS macht das glücklicherweiße auch so dass die Daten komplett aus dem RAM gerechnet werden sofern es rein passt.

danke schon einmal für die antworten.
hat noch jemand einen Tipp für einen guten RAID Controller der dafür besser geeignet wäre als der den ich bereits im Einsatz habe?
 
Zurück
Oben